WebMar 17, 2024 · A person experiencing a night terror will suddenly begin to show signs of panic and terror while sleeping such as screaming, flailing, or kicking. This is usually accompanied by other symptoms like rapid heart rate and breathing, flushing of the skin, sweating, dilation of the pupils, and tensing of the muscles .

WebWell, "pavor nocturnus" is literally Latin for "sleep terror"--so those phrases are just saying the exact same thing in two separate languages. In addition, "pavor nocturnus" is used most commonly to refer to sleep terrors in children. On the other hand, the phrase "incubus attacks" is commonly used to refer to sleep terrors in adults.
